Galaxie's usage pattern, beyond the headline number

Galaxie splits its recorded history at 2020: 60% of all births land in the more recent half, 40% in the earlier half, a lean toward present-day use rather than a passing spike. The single quietest year was 2019 (5 births) -- compare that against the 2023 peak of 9 for a sense of just how much the name's popularity has swung.
